Creación de un blog con Jekyll: un generador de sitios estáticos

Hoy en día tener un blog personal o empresarial es casi una necesidad. Sin embargo, crear y mantener un blog puede ser una tarea desalentadora, especialmente para aquellos que no son expertos en tecnología. Afortunadamente, existen herramientas y plataformas disponibles que pueden facilitar mucho el proceso. Una de esas herramientas es Jekyll, un generador de sitios estáticos que le permite crear y administrar un blog con facilidad.

Entonces, ¿qué es Jekyll? En términos simples, Jekyll es un generador de sitios estáticos que toma texto escrito en un lenguaje de marcado simple, como Markdown, y utiliza plantillas para generar archivos HTML estáticos. Esto significa que, a diferencia de los sitios web dinámicos, Jekyll no depende de una base de datos ni de un procesamiento del lado del servidor. En cambio, genera todo el sitio web por adelantado y solo envía archivos estáticos al navegador del usuario.

Una de las principales ventajas de utilizar Jekyll es su sencillez. Dado que no depende de bases de datos ni de procesamiento del lado del servidor, configurar y mantener un blog Jekyll es mucho más fácil en comparación con los sistemas de gestión de contenidos tradicionales como WordPress. Esto también significa que los sitios Jekyll suelen ser más rápidos y seguros, ya que no son susceptibles a las vulnerabilidades de las bases de datos y del servidor.

Además de su simplicidad, Jekyll también ofrece un alto grado de flexibilidad y personalización. Jekyll te permite usar tu editor de texto favorito para escribir las publicaciones de tu blog en Markdown, y también puedes usar HTML o CSS para personalizar la apariencia de tu blog. Además, el sistema de plantillas de Jekyll le permite crear diseños y parciales reutilizables, lo que facilita mantener un diseño coherente en todo su sitio web.

LEAR  Diseño colaborativo de interfaz de usuario: flujos de trabajo de equipo eficaces

Otra ventaja de Jekyll es su integración con sistemas de control de versiones como Git. Esto significa que puede realizar un seguimiento de los cambios en las publicaciones de su blog y en los archivos de su sitio web, colaborar con otras personas y volver fácilmente a versiones anteriores si es necesario.

Para comenzar con Jekyll, necesitará tener algunos conocimientos básicos de HTML, CSS y Markdown. También necesitarás tener Ruby instalado en tu computadora, ya que Jekyll está construido usando el lenguaje de programación Ruby. Sin embargo, una vez que haya configurado Jekyll, podrá aprovechar sus potentes funciones, como la compatibilidad integrada con Sass, canalizaciones de activos y archivos de datos.

En conclusión, crear un blog con Jekyll es una excelente opción para quienes desean un sitio web simple, rápido y seguro. Con su facilidad de uso, flexibilidad e integración con sistemas de control de versiones, Jekyll es una poderosa herramienta para crear y mantener un blog. Si usted es un desarrollador que busca una plataforma de blogs simple o un usuario sin conocimientos técnicos que desea iniciar un blog, definitivamente vale la pena considerar Jekyll.